Among them, major overseas technology companies such as amazon and Apple are applying the \"biophilia hypothesis,\" which states that humans instinctively seek nature, to the design of their office spaces as biophilic design. Interest in biophilia is growing rapidly, as many people have had the refreshing experience of immersing themselves in nature. Other typical influencing factors on people are sound. There are many known examples of its influence on people's cognitive function and emotional state.<br \/>\nOn the other hand, these experiences are sensory, and it is important to accumulate scientific evidence in the future. Not only conventional psychological tests and physiological analysis, but also multifaceted verification incorporating newly developed measurement techniques and other methods, as well as quantitative evaluation of their effects, should clarify the relationship between nature, sound, and people.
